West Ham United vs Leeds United Match Preview


In this week 22 match on the 16th of January, West Ham United plays host to Leeds United in a clash of the Premier League. Weather on match day is looking like a cloudy and cool day, with daytime temperatures of only 8 degrees, which will make playing unpleasant. West Ham United is fresh off their 2-0 shutout win against Norwich City. Jarrod Bowen struck first for West Ham United in the 42nd minute on a feed from Vladimír Coufal, then Jarrod Bowen added another in the 83rd minute At the end of 90 a dissapointed Norwich City couldn’t manage to score, and West Ham United took the shutout win. Leeds United’s most prolific scorer has been Raphinha. He has netted 2 goals over the last five matches. Both Manuel Lanzini and Jarrod Bowen have been the hottest scorers for West Ham United in the last five each having scored 3 goals

Pablo Fornals, Angelo Ogbonna and Aaron Cresswell are unavailable to play for West Ham United, while Leeds United will be without Patrick Bamford, Liam Cooper, Kalvin Phillips, Jamie Shackleton and Pascal Struijk.
